Balanced 1U rack server

The HP ProLiant DL160 Gen9 fits a single Intel Xeon E5-2623 v3 quad-core processor running at 3 GHz with 8 GB of DDR4 ECC memory. Two 500 GB 7.2K 2.5-inch SATA drives connect to the onboard B140i software RAID controller supporting levels 0, 1 and 5. The 1U chassis offers eight SFF bays for future expansion.

Redundant 550 W power and thermal design

Dual hot-swap 550 W power supplies share the load and keep the system running if one unit fails. The 1U airflow path pulls cool air from the front through the drive cage and across the processor and memory before exhausting at the rear. Fan speeds scale with inlet temperature to limit acoustic output in typical rack environments.

B140i RAID and Matrox G200 graphics

The integrated B140i controller provides hardware-assisted RAID 0, 1 and 5 for SATA drives only, removing the need for a separate HBA in entry configurations. The Matrox G200 chip delivers basic 2D video for local console or remote KVM access without consuming a PCIe slot. No operating system is included, so the installer chooses the hypervisor or OS.
